Full Recipe:

Ingredients:

  • 2 tablespoons olive oil

  • 1 small onion, finely chopped

  • 2 cloves garlic, minced

  • 1/2 teaspoon salt

  • 1/4 teaspoon black pepper

  • 1/2 teaspoon dried basil

  • 1/2 teaspoon sugar (optional)

  • 1/4 teaspoon red pepper flakes (optional)

  • 1 (28 oz) can crushed tomatoes

  • 1 1/2 cups chicken or vegetable broth

  • 1/2 cup heavy cream

  • 1 tablespoon tomato paste (optional, for richer flavor)

  • Fresh basil or shredded parmesan for garnish (optional)

Directions:

  1. In a large pot, heat olive oil over medium heat.

  2. Add chopped onion and cook for 4-5 minutes, stirring occasionally, until translucent.

  3. Stir in garlic, salt, pepper, basil, sugar, and red pepper flakes. Cook for 1 minute until fragrant.

  4. Add crushed tomatoes, broth, and tomato paste. Bring to a simmer and cook uncovered for 10-15 minutes.

  5. Turn off the heat and blend the soup with an immersion blender (or in batches in a countertop blender) until smooth.

  6. Return the soup to low heat and stir in the heavy cream. Heat gently for 2-3 more minutes without boiling.

  7. Ladle into bowls and garnish with fresh basil or parmesan if desired.

Prep Time: 5 minutes | Cooking Time: 15 minutes | Total Time: 20 minutes
Kcal: 190 kcal | Servings: 4 servings

Health Benefits of Tomato Soup

Tomatoes are a powerhouse of nutrition. They’re rich in antioxidants, particularly lycopene, which has been linked to heart health, reduced cancer risk, and anti-aging properties. Lycopene becomes even more bioavailable when tomatoes are cooked, making soups and sauces a smart way to absorb this nutrient.

In addition, tomatoes offer vitamin C, potassium, folate, and vitamin K. This soup, while creamy, can be easily customized to be healthier by using a lighter cream or even plant-based alternatives, allowing you to enjoy its nutritional benefits without compromise.

Olive oil, used to sauté the aromatics, provides healthy fats that support brain health and reduce inflammation. Paired with low-sodium broth and fresh herbs, this soup becomes more than comfort food it’s a wholesome, healing bowl.

How to Customize Creamy Tomato Soup

One of the most beautiful aspects of this recipe is its versatility. You can easily tweak it to fit dietary needs, flavor preferences, or what’s available in your kitchen:

1. Make It Vegan or Dairy-Free

Swap the heavy cream with coconut milk, cashew cream, or a dairy-free creamer for a vegan version. Use vegetable broth instead of chicken broth, and you’ll still get that luscious texture with a slightly different flavor profile.

2. Add a Protein Boost

If you’re looking to turn this into a heartier meal, stir in some cooked quinoa, chickpeas, or shredded chicken. This adds both texture and protein, making it more filling.

3. Spice It Up

Craving a bit of a kick? Add more red pepper flakes or a dash of hot sauce. You can also incorporate smoked paprika or chipotle powder for a smoky, bold twist.

4. Garnish Creatively

A sprinkle of shredded parmesan, a drizzle of basil pesto, or croutons can take the soup to another level. Freshly cracked pepper and a few fresh basil leaves always add a nice final touch.

5. Thicken It Naturally

If you prefer an even thicker consistency, blend in a cooked potato or a handful of cooked rice. These act as natural thickeners without the need for flour or starch.

Storage and Meal Prep Tips

This soup is perfect for meal prep. It stores beautifully and the flavors deepen over time, making leftovers even better the next day.

  • Refrigeration: Store in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 4-5 days.

  • Freezing: Allow the soup to cool completely and freeze in portions for up to 3 months. Use freezer-safe containers or zip-top bags (laid flat for easy stacking).

  • Reheating: Reheat on the stove over medium heat, stirring occasionally. If the soup has thickened too much, just add a splash of broth or cream to loosen it up.

This makes it a great make-ahead meal for busy weeks, cold seasons, or when you just need a comforting bowl on standby.
